The VP Federal Government Affairs is accountable for developing and implementing bold federal advocacy strategies by directing contracted lobbyists and other consultants to advance the WelbeHealth PACE mission. The strategies will include cultivating effective relationships with regulators elected officials member associations and other relevant key addition this role will proactively influence initiate monitor and track policy changes relevant to WelbeHealth.

This role is different because the VP Federal Government Affairs at WelbeHealth:

  • Directly shapes the future of the PACE model at the federal level partnering with CMS and policymakers to influence regulations that determine how care is delivered to our most vulnerable seniors rather than advocating from the sidelines
  • Owns strategy and execution - driving federal advocacy guiding lobbyists accelerating PACE approvals and translating policy into real operational outcomes as WelbeHealth expands into new markets

On the day-to-day you will:

  • Develop and implement an effective federal engagement strategy that results in outstanding relationships with regulators and elected officials
  • Direct government affairs advocacy efforts to facilitate timely approvals of PACE applications resolve regulatory issues for operating PACE programs and influence policy changes that support the WelbeHealth mission
  • Establish a proactive strategy to maintain a high level of situational awareness on policy matters identifying risks and opportunities for WelbeHealth
  • Maintain positive relationships with key external stakeholders including trade associations other healthcare entities PACE organizations workgroups advocacy groups relevant consumer groups etc.
  • Identify manage and effectively leverage WelbeHealth lobbyists consultants or other resources to achieve WelbeHealths advocacy goals
  • Effectively track synthesize and communicate relevant government policy changes (laws regulations guidance) impacting WelbeHealth
  • Represent and engage effectively on behalf of WelbeHealth in relevant associations inclusive of board and board committee memberships as well as collaborate with cross-functional departments such as Growth Strategy Business Development Compliance Marketing Community Partnerships Health Plan Operations and Program Operations

Job requirements include:

  • Masters degree in public policy or relevant field; professional experience may be substituted
  • Minimum of seven (7) years of relevant experience engaging with federal regulators or elected officials required
  • Minimum of seven (7) years of experience as a leader in healthcare eldercare or human services policy required
  • Direct experience with Center for Medicare and Medicaid Services required; recent CMS experience highly preferred
  • Located in Washington DC highly preferred; alternatively ability to travel to Washington D.C. on frequent as-needed basis is required
  • Ability to travel to WelbeHealth markets and other travel as needed
  • Persuasion and rhetorical skills needed to successfully influence elected officials and regulators
  • Outstanding written and oral communication skills including presenting information in a concise manner and effectively facilitating discussions

We are seeking a VP Federal Government Affairs that has a track record in progressive leadership in healthcare eldercare or human services policy with direct experience with Medicaid Services.
